Interglobe Aviation Q2 Results: Net loss widens to Rs 1,583 cr; revenue soars123% YOY

Inter Globe Aviation, which runs IndiGo airline, on Friday said its September quarter net loss widened to Rs 1,583 crore from Rs 1,435.6 crore posted in the same quarter last year even as its revenue from operations rose 122.8% year on year (YoY) to Rs 12,497.6 crore during the period. Should you buy, hold or sell InterGlobe Aviation after Q1 numbers

New Delhi: Brokerage firms remain mixed over India’s largest airline carriage (IndiGo) after its Q1 numbers, which were majorly better than Street expectations.
